So, I think for the most part the Americans biggest concern was Russia or Russian allies using Nuclear Weapons against them and then full blown out Nuclear War. Correct me if I’m wrong, but I also believe that it was also how fast the Russians were coming under possession of Nuclear Weapons and wanted to keep up with Russia in terms of their achievements as the Russians sent Sputnik 1 into orbit in 1957 and were the first to ever do something like so. (It’s why we have science class. Thank the Russians for that one) The Russians were pretty advanced and the US wanted to keep up. This could be seen simply as a peeing race or as a way to keep themselves protected and from going to war as both sides knew and understand what would happen should they use Nuclear Arms in war.
